A guide to Phlebotomy Technician Course
What is Phlebotomy? Phlebotomy is the process of drawing blood from a patient for diagnostic or therapeutic purposes. A phlebotomist is a healthcare professional who is trained to perform this procedure. What is a Phlebotomy Technician? A phlebotomy technician is a healthcare professional who is trained to draw blood from patients. They work in hospitals, clinics, and other healthcare settings. Phlebotomy technicians are responsible for collecting blood samples, labelling them correctly, and transporting them to the laboratory for analysis. What is phlebotomy technician course? A phlebotomy technician course is a specialized training program that teaches students the skills they need to become a phlebotomy technician. The course typically covers topics such as anatomy and physiology, blood collection techniques, infection control and safety, communication skills, medical terminology, and legal and ethical issues.
